Job Duties
Troubleshoot, diagnose, service, repair and install dock and door equipment.
Perform all assigned planned maintenance on customer dock and door equipment.
Welding.
Maintain a service van and its inventory.
Process paperwork after completion of each job.
Minimum Qualifications
Less than 2 years related experience
High school diploma or equivalent
Valid driver's license, good driving record, and ability to safely operate lift trucks.
Preferred Qualifications
Technical school graduate preferred.
Mechanical and electrical aptitude.
Welding experience.
Good written and verbal communication and customer care skills.
Read and understand hydraulic and electrical schematics
